package org.eclipse.emf.teneo.hibernate.mapping.eav;
import java.util.ArrayList;
import java.util.List;
import org.eclipse.emf.ecore.InternalEObject;
/**
* Stores a multi containment EReference value.
*
* @author <a href="mtaal@elver.org">Martin Taal</a>
*/
public class EAVMultiNonContainmentEReferenceValueHolder extends EAVMultiValueHolder {
private List<EAVSingleNonContainmentEReferenceValueHolder> referenceValues;
private EAVDelegatingList ecoreObjectList = null;
@SuppressWarnings("unchecked")
public void set(Object value) {
// set to null first, if there is at least one value then it is set to a
// value
setMandatoryValue(null);
final List<?> values = (List<Object>) value;
referenceValues = new ArrayList<EAVSingleNonContainmentEReferenceValueHolder>();
int index = 0;
for (Object o : values) {
final EAVSingleNonContainmentEReferenceValueHolder eavValue = (EAVSingleNonContainmentEReferenceValueHolder) getElement(o);
eavValue.setListIndex(index++);
referenceValues.add(eavValue);
setMandatoryValue(NOT_NULL_VALUE);
}
}
public Object getElement(Object value) {
EAVSingleNonContainmentEReferenceValueHolder valueHolder = new EAVSingleNonContainmentEReferenceValueHolder();
valueHolder.setEStructuralFeature(getEStructuralFeature());
valueHolder.setOwner(getOwner());
valueHolder.setValueOwner(this);
valueHolder.setHbDataStore(getHbDataStore());
valueHolder.set(value);
return valueHolder;
}
public Object get(InternalEObject owner) {
if (ecoreObjectList != null) {
return ecoreObjectList;
}
// final DelegatingLateLoadingList<Object> lateLoadingList = new
// DelegatingLateLoadingList<Object>();
// lateLoadingList.setPersistentList(referenceValues);
final EAVDelegatingEcoreEList<Object> ecoreList = new EAVDelegatingEcoreEList<Object>(
(InternalEObject) owner);
ecoreList.setValueHolderOwner(this);
ecoreList.setEStructuralFeature(getEStructuralFeature());
ecoreList.setPersistentList(referenceValues);
ecoreObjectList = ecoreList;
return ecoreList;
}
public Object getValue() {
return referenceValues;
}
public List<EAVSingleNonContainmentEReferenceValueHolder> getReferenceValues() {
return referenceValues;
}
public void setReferenceValues(List<EAVSingleNonContainmentEReferenceValueHolder> referenceValues) {
this.referenceValues = referenceValues;
((EAVDelegatingList) get((InternalEObject) getOwner())).setPersistentList(referenceValues);
}
}
